Title: Toru Inake: Innovator in Paper Processing Technology
Introduction
Toru Inake is a notable inventor based in Tokyo, Japan. He has made significant contributions to the field of paper processing technology, holding a total of 3 patents. His innovative designs focus on improving the efficiency and reliability of paper handling systems.
Latest Patents
One of Inake's latest patents is a "Sheet Paper Processing Device." This invention features a base machine that includes a feed path for conveying paper sheets and a validator that identifies the sheets being processed. The device also incorporates an expansion unit with multiple stacking portions that can continue operation even when a conveyance abnormality occurs. This ensures that the paper sheets are directed to the appropriate stacking area without immediate interruption.
Another significant patent is the "Paper Sheet Detection Device, Paper Sheet Detection Method, and Paper Sheet Processing Device." This invention utilizes an optical sensor to detect the presence of paper sheets in a path of emitted light. It includes a storage portion for threshold values and an estimating portion that determines whether a paper sheet is present based on the light levels received. The device also features a light amount adjusting portion to maintain optimal detection conditions.
